AbstractMaterial fatigue is one of the elementary causes of damage in steel construction besides corrosion and abrasion. Design recommendations require that weld seams are placed in less stressed areas due to the crack-sensitive nature of the welded areas. As a result, unwelded areas of the components such as free cut plate edges gain technical and economic relevance as locations for potential fatigue cracks. In the metal processing industry, different thermal cutting processes are frequently used. During the process, unwanted boundary conditions can lead to undesired cuts in the component geometry during the cutting process. These process dysfunctions lead to incorrect components and to rejects. This article presents results of fatigue test data of oxy-fuel thermal cut edges of defect-free and faulty repair-welded samples to investigate the influence of competing notches on the cut edge. Specimens are made from construction steels S355N and S690Q of a 20-mm-thick plate. The presented data shows that the fatigue strength of the damaged cut edges can be recovered by the repair procedure and does not show any reduction of the fatigue strength due to the determined pores or other metallurgical notches of the repaired section.

The purpose of the research was to investigate whether the companies involved in strategic business alliances (henceforth referred to as the SBA) have a higher level of open innovation and better business results in the metal industry in the EU country, namely Slovenia. The survey was carried out in 115 companies, where the aforementioned relations and their influence were studied applying appropriate statistical methods (e.g. the Mann-Whitney Test, Chi-Square statistics, t-test, etc.). The sample encompassed four clusters and R&D centres from metal-processing industry. The results showed that SBA have a significantly strong impact on companies’ open innovation as well as more efficient cooperation with universities and research institutions. Among the companies involved in SBA, the portion of innovations generated in cooperation with their business partners accounted for 57.7%, while those, not involved in SBA, the same indicator amounts to 19%. In addition, the results showed that the majority of business results, in companies involved in SBA, were above average, compared to the industry sector average values. The value added per employee within companies involved in the SBA was significantly higher than the industry average, as well as the profits; difference was more than threefold. It may be concluded that SBA represent an important bridge in the transformation from a closed innovation model to a model of open innovation, resulting in better business performance. Important implication for companies is related to the message that cooperation with competitors may bring value added to all companies involved.

The article analyzes the current state of the metal processing industry and the secondary raw materials market, considers the problems and identifies prospects for its development. The relevance of the article is due to the rapid development of new information and communication technologies, thanks to which there is a new way to manage the processes of collection and processing of secondary raw materials, which is based on fundamentally different rules than the traditional one. To create conditions, it is advisable to work on improving the reliability and international comparability of data, the development of quality standards of secondary raw materials, the creation of an information platform of common access, which will not only monitor the development of the economic system, but also to share information with all participants in the sector. The results of the study can be used to improve the methodology for the formation of mechanisms for the effective use of secondary raw materials by processing companies.

The purpose of this research is. 1) mapping the distribution pattern of the metal processing industry in Nagari Sungai Pua. 2) publish the profile and potential of the metal processing industry in Nagari Sungai Pua using a WebGIS based geographic information system. This type of research is quantitative descriptive. In analyzing the distribution pattern of the metal processing industry, the method used is the Nearest Neighborhood analysis method and the method used in building WebGIS is the waterfall method The result of this study are: 1) the distribution pattern of the metal processing industry in Nagari Sungai Pua is random with a T index value of 0,884269. 2) publication related to the profile and potential of the metal processing industry in Nagari Sungai Pua can be accessed using WebGIS which has been successfully build using the waterfall method with the domain address http://webgisindustrisungaipua.000webhostapp.com. This WebGIS presents information about the metal processing industry in Nagari Sungai Pua which is presented in the form of maps containing data ranging from the distribution of metal processing industries, profiles and industrial potential that can be seen by the public so that information related to this industry can be accessed easily.

Metal swarf is unavoidable material in metal processing industry, also metal swarf treatment lead to cost savings by metal waste reduction and removing the cutting fluid waste, that cause to increasing process stability and metal value. It is interested that in how to recycle metal swarf especially when swarf surrounded by cutting fluid, is considered because these waste are classified as hazardous waste. The aim of the study is to increase the process efficiency and environmental performance by metal waste reduction at source which are the first step of the waste hierarchy. The results of the experiments showed that 3391 tons of metal swarf coated with cutting fluids which contained 2.29% cutting fluid be produced annually. It has been found that if the total amount of cutting fluid on the swarf surface be reduced to less than 1% leads to a significant mass reduction in the amount of hazardous waste. In this research, it was considered, 107,922 USD profit at the end of first year and 205,278 USD at the end of second year would be obtained by reducing the cutting fluid content from 2.29% to 0.8% with using cutting fluid that surrounded metal swarf separation equipment in manufacturing location.

Abstract The development of enterprises in the globalised world depends on their development potential and ability to compete with other entities. Of key importance in the field of competitiveness is access to innovative technologies providing a competitive advantage and the ability to cooperate in their acquisition with other entities, e.g. in clusters. The authors attempted to identify the sources of technology and financing options used by companies in the metal processing industry. The studied entities are part of a cluster of national importance, and the adopted research method is based on an interview questionnaire. Studies have shown that most companies buy ready-made solutions and to a lesser extent cooperate in acquiring technology. Noticeable is also a relatively large share of financing investments in new technologies from public funds.
